Output b0cc491b68cb1b51cf8ad2e98f9435d8d51e8149bcf1272591c759845099eda6:0

value
25453333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f84efa8760ee9a9f9100bd88406f73e9b96e8e3 OP_EQUAL
address
3EmsoYPxhQGgpeLPyRasaE2kzFFmCDdpRt
transaction
b0cc491b68cb1b51cf8ad2e98f9435d8d51e8149bcf1272591c759845099eda6
confirmations
184784
spent
true